Does the graph shown to the right represent a proportional or non-proportional relationship? How do you know?

Mathematics
1 answer:
ch4aika [34]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

proportional  relationship

Step-by-step explanation:

proportional relationships are straight lines that go thru the origin

This is a straight line  going thru (0,0) so it is a proportional relationship

-4(5+n) = -12 need help​
user100 [1]

First, simplify out the brackets:

-20 - 4n = -12

Then, combine like terms by moving the -20 to the other side

-4n = -12 + 20

-4n = 8

Divide by -4 on both sides to isolate the n

n = 8/-4

n = -2
